mysql如何查询表中所有的字段?

查询所有字段是查询表中的所有数据。使用MySQL的SELECT语句可以实现这一操作,基本语法为:SELECT 字段名 表名。若查询结果中字段顺序与表中不一致,结果将按照指定字段顺序显示。如果表内字段较多,指定字段逐一操作较为繁琐且容易出错,此时可使用通配符“*”代替所有字段名,简化SQL语句书写,语法格式为:...
mysql如何查询表中所有的字段?
查询所有字段是查询表中的所有数据。使用MySQL的SELECT语句可以实现这一操作,基本语法为:SELECT 字段名 表名。

若查询结果中字段顺序与表中不一致,结果将按照指定字段顺序显示。如果表内字段较多,指定字段逐一操作较为繁琐且容易出错,此时可使用通配符“*”代替所有字段名,简化SQL语句书写,语法格式为:SELECT * 表名。

使用“*”可以查询stu表所有数据,结果显示顺序需与表中字段一致,不能自定义。接下来介绍如何指定字段查询数据,使用SELECT语句时,通过列出字段名即可查询表中特定字段的数据。

在处理复杂业务需求时,可能需要对查询结果进行排序、分组和分页等高级操作。MySQL提供了ORDER BY关键字进行排序,具体语法格式为:SELECT 字段名 表名 ORDER BY 字段名 ASC/DESC;其中ASC代表升序,DESC代表降序。

统计数据时,MySQL提供了COUNT()、SUM()、AVG()、MAX()、MIN()等聚合函数。COUNT()函数用于计算行数或特定列的值行数,SUM()函数用于计算指定列数值和,AVG()函数用于计算指定列平均值,MAX()函数用于计算指定列最大值,MIN()函数用于计算指定列最小值。IFNULL()函数用于判断字段是否为NULL,为NULL替换为数值0。

在查询数据分组时,可以使用GROUP BY关键字进行分组查询。例如,查询学生表中按性别分组的数据,或查询员工表中按部门编号分组的工资总和。

在分组查询后,可能需要对数据进行过滤,MySQL提供了HAVING子句,用于在分组后对数据进行过滤,语法格式为:SELECT 字段名 表名 GROUP BY 字段名 HAVING 条件。

为了优化查询性能,MySQL提供了LIMIT关键字用于限制查询结果数量,实现分页效果。LIMIT后面可以跟两个参数:m为起始索引,默认值为0,n为从m+1条记录开始取的记录数。

通过使用以上MySQL高级查询功能,可以高效处理各种复杂的数据查询需求。2024-09-01
mengvlog 阅读 11 次 更新于 2025-07-20 16:30:01 我来答关注问题0
  •  阿暄生活 MYSQL中怎么直接查看一个表的字符集

    在MySQL中,查看一个表的字符集的方法是使用命令:SHOW CREATE TABLE table_name;,例如,对于名为"user"的表,命令应为:SHOW CREATE TABLE user;执行该命令后,将返回一个包含表创建语句的表格,其中包括字符集信息。例如:| user | CREATE TABLE `user` ( `pkid` int(8) NOT NULL, `username...

  • 查询所有字段是查询表中的所有数据。使用MySQL的SELECT语句可以实现这一操作,基本语法为:SELECT 字段名 表名。若查询结果中字段顺序与表中不一致,结果将按照指定字段顺序显示。如果表内字段较多,指定字段逐一操作较为繁琐且容易出错,此时可使用通配符“*”代替所有字段名,简化SQL语句书写,语法格式为:S...

  • 具体来说,可以在SQL查询中直接写出SELECT语句,包括表中的所有字段,并确保查询语句中没有任何额外的限制条件或操作。例如,可以使用如下查询语句:SELECT * FROM table_name;这里的*表示查询表中的所有字段。如果表中的字段非常多,直接使用*可能会导致查询结果集过大,影响性能。在这种情况下,可以考虑...

  • 在Java中,要查询mySQL数据库中所有表的字段,可以使用如下代码示例:首先定义查询语句,例如针对特定表查询:String query = "SELECT * FROM " + ITEM_TABLE + " WHERE item_id = 1";执行查询:rs = st.executeQuery(query);获取结果集元数据:ResultSetMetaData metaData = rs.getMetaData();遍历元...

  • 一、查询数据 在MySQL中,使用SELECT语句查询数据时,all可以帮助我们显示所有的列数据。例如,我们有以下一张表:表名:student | id | name | age | gender | |—-|——|—–|——–| | 1 | Tom | 18 | Male | | 2 | Jack...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部